SAR Class 10E 10-001
Description:
In 1985 and 1986 the South African Railways placed fifty Class 10E heavy goods 3 kV DC electric locomotives with a Co-Co wheel arrangement in mainline service, numbered in the range from 10-001 to 10-050. The locomotive, which makes use of either regenerative or rheostatic braking as the situation demands, was designed by Toshiba of Japan and built by Union Carriage and Wagon in Nigel, Transvaal.

TFR Class 18E 18-751 (Series 2)
Description:
The rebuilding of dual cab Class 6E1, Series 2 to Series 8 locomotives to single cab Class 18E, Series 2 locomotives commenced in 2009, with their unit numbers in the range from 18-421 to 18-435 and from 18-600 up. The rebuilding included the installation of Alsthom micro-processor control technology and was done by Transnet Rail Engineering (previously Transwerk and later Transnet Engineering) at its Koedoespoort shops in Pretoria, Gauteng. In the process their number 1 end cabs were stripped of all controls in order to have a toilet installed.
No. 18-751 was rebuilt from Class 6E1, Series 2 no. E1268 and commissioned in 2013.
